#2a6849 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2a6849 is composed of 16.5% red, 40.8%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.8%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 150 degrees, a saturation of 42.5% and a lightness of 28.6%. #2a6849 color hex could be obtained by blending #54d092 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#2a6849 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2a6849 has RGB values of R:42, G:104,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0, Y:0.3,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 2779209.

Shades and Tints of #2a6849
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030604 is the darkest color, while #f7fc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#2a6849
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464c49 is the less saturated color, while #038f49 is the most saturated one.
